Bluish tint to … WebYour GP or an asthma nurse can help confirm or rule out a diagnosis of asthma. They can do this by: talking about your symptoms, what sets them off, and when you get them asking if anyone else in the family has asthma finding out if you, or anyone in your family, have other allergies, like hay fever testing how your lungs are working

It does not cover managing severe asthma or acute asthma attacks. green white rampWebApr 9, 2024 · What to do if you have an asthma attack If you think you're having an asthma attack, you should: Sit up straight – try to keep calm. Take one puff of your reliever inhaler (usually blue) every 30 to 60 seconds up to 10 puffs.
